// -------------------------------------------------------------- similarity
// Perceptual comparison happens in OKLab: Euclidean distance there tracks
// how different two colors *look*, which raw RGB distance does not (RGB
// overweights differences the eye barely sees and vice versa).
function hexToOklab(hex) {
const srgb = [hex.slice(1, 3), hex.slice(3, 5), hex.slice(5, 7)]
.map((h) => parseInt(h, 16) / 255)
.map((v) => (v <= 0.04045 ? v / 12.92 : ((v + 0.055) / 1.055) ** 2.4));
const [r, g, b] = srgb;
const l = Math.cbrt(0.4122214708 * r + 0.5363325363 * g + 0.0514459929 * b);
const m = Math.cbrt(0.2119034982 * r + 0.6806995451 * g + 0.1073969566 * b);
const s = Math.cbrt(0.0883024619 * r + 0.2817188376 * g + 0.6299787005 * b);
return {
L: 0.2104542553 * l + 0.793617785 * m - 0.0040720468 * s,
a: 1.9779984951 * l - 2.428592205 * m + 0.4505937099 * s,
b: 0.0259040371 * l + 0.7827717662 * m - 0.808675766 * s,
};
}
// Hue angle (degrees) and chroma from OKLab's a/b plane. Chroma below
// ~0.03 is visually a neutral (gray/beige/near-black); its hue angle is
// noise and must not count toward "same hue family".
function oklch(lab) {
const chroma = Math.hypot(lab.a, lab.b);
const hue = ((Math.atan2(lab.b, lab.a) * 180) / Math.PI + 360) % 360;
return { L: lab.L, chroma, hue };
}
const NEUTRAL_CHROMA = 0.03;
const HUE_FAMILY_DEG = 30; // primaries closer than this share a hue family
const DUPLICATE_DE = 0.09; // OKLab distance under which two roles look alike
function hueDelta(h1, h2) {
const d = Math.abs(h1 - h2) % 360;
return d > 180 ? 360 - d : d;
}
// Compares two palettes role by role. Verdict pieces:
// sameHueFamily — both primaries are chromatic and within HUE_FAMILY_DEG
// duplicateRoles — roles whose OKLab distance is under DUPLICATE_DE
// flagged — sameHueFamily, or 3+ of the 4 roles are near-duplicates
function comparePalettes(pa, pb) {
const roles = Object.keys(pa).filter((r) => r in pb);
const distances = {};
const duplicateRoles = [];
for (const role of roles) {
const la = hexToOklab(pa[role].hex);
const lb = hexToOklab(pb[role].hex);
const d = Math.hypot(la.L - lb.L, la.a - lb.a, la.b - lb.b);
distances[role] = Math.round(d * 1000) / 1000;
if (d < DUPLICATE_DE) duplicateRoles.push(role);
}
let sameHueFamily = false;
if (pa.primary && pb.primary) {
const ca = oklch(hexToOklab(pa.primary.hex));
const cb = oklch(hexToOklab(pb.primary.hex));
sameHueFamily =
ca.chroma >= NEUTRAL_CHROMA &&
cb.chroma >= NEUTRAL_CHROMA &&
hueDelta(ca.hue, cb.hue) < HUE_FAMILY_DEG;
}
return { distances, duplicateRoles, sameHueFamily, flagged: sameHueFamily || duplicateRoles.length >= 3 };
}
